Who Is Robert Kiyosaki?

Robert Toru Kiyosaki was born on April 8, 1947, in Hilo, Hawaii. He is an American businessman, author, investor, and motivational speaker who has dedicated his life to teaching people about financial independence. He is best known for creating the “Rich Dad” philosophy, a framework that encourages individuals to build assets rather than rely solely on earned income from a job.

He grew up in a modest household. His father, Ralph Kiyosaki, worked as an academic in Hawaii’s Department of Education, while his mother was a homemaker. From an early age, Robert saw the difference between traditional education and financial reality. He often describes two father figures in his life – his biological father, the “Poor Dad,” and his best friend’s father, the “Rich Dad.” The contrast between these two men became the inspiration for his most famous book.

After high school, Robert attended the United States Merchant Marine Academy, where he learned discipline and leadership. Later, he served as a helicopter gunship pilot in the Vietnam War. His years in the military shaped his courage and ability to take calculated risks, traits that became essential in his business life.

The Birth of the Rich Dad Idea

The “Rich Dad” concept began as a simple lesson Robert learned from observing two different mindsets about money. His “Poor Dad” believed in studying hard, getting a degree, and finding a stable job. His “Rich Dad,” on the other hand, taught him about ownership, assets, and entrepreneurship. The book Rich Dad Poor Dad, published in 1997, brought these ideas to the world and sold over 40 million copies in more than 50 languages.

The success of Rich Dad Poor Dad made Robert a global celebrity in the field of financial education. He went on to write more than 25 additional books, including Cashflow Quadrant, Rich Dad’s Guide to Investing, Unfair Advantage, The Business of the 21st Century, and Fake. His books focus on financial freedom, asset building, and the importance of understanding how money works.

Along with his wife, Kim Kiyosaki, he founded The Rich Dad Company. The business offers educational products, financial games, online courses, and global seminars focused on building wealth through smart investing and entrepreneurship.

His Real Estate Empire

Real estate is the foundation of Robert’s wealth-building philosophy. He calls it “the safest path to financial freedom.” His investments include apartment complexes, commercial spaces, and syndication projects across several states. Rather than buying and selling quickly, he follows a “buy and hold” strategy that generates long-term rental income.

He uses leverage, or what he calls “good debt,” to expand his portfolio. This means borrowing money to acquire assets that pay for themselves through income. He argues that the rich use debt as a tool to grow wealth, while the poor use debt to buy liabilities.

The Rich Dad Company

Robert’s main business, The Rich Dad Company, remains one of the most profitable parts of his empire. The company sells books, organizes live events, and provides online courses on topics like investing, business ownership, and financial management. It also created the CASHFLOW board game, designed to teach players how to make smart financial decisions.

Although the company has faced legal challenges in the past, it continues to thrive through digital content, webinars, and partnerships with educators worldwide. This steady performance keeps robert kiyosaki net worth consistent despite market fluctuations.

Critics vs. Supporters

Financial experts often question Kiyosaki’s advice, claiming it oversimplifies complex topics. Some argue that his examples are unrealistic for average people, especially when he talks about borrowing millions to buy properties. Others believe that his ideas only work for those with existing capital.

However, supporters view him as a visionary who challenges traditional thinking. They credit him for inspiring millions to learn about money and take control of their finances. Regardless of where people stand, few can deny that his work has made financial education mainstream.

Personal Life

Robert Kiyosaki was married to Kim Kiyosaki, who was also his business partner and co-author of several financial books. The couple divorced in 2017 but maintained a professional relationship for some time afterward. He has never had children, explaining that he wanted to dedicate his time to teaching financial literacy globally.

He currently resides in Arizona, where he continues to manage his investments, write books, and host interviews. Outside of business, he enjoys motorcycles, travel, and mentoring young entrepreneurs.
